titleOfInvention Functional solution supply system
abstract A sulfuric acid electrolyte solution is efficiently generated as a functional solution, and persulfuric acid produced by electrolysis is suppressed from self-decomposition and is efficiently supplied to the use side. A functional solution supply system for producing a functional solution by electrolyzing a sulfuric acid solution and supplying it to a use side, wherein the system stores a storage tank (2) storing a sulfuric acid solution and an electrolytic device (electrolyte cell (3)) for electrolyzing a sulfuric acid solution. And heating means (heater 4) for heating the sulfuric acid solution, cooling means (cooler 4) for cooling the sulfuric acid solution, and sulfuric acid solution discharged from the storage tank 2 without the heating means.
